A cable used to lift heavy materials like steel I-beams must be strong enough to resist breaking even under a load of 1.4 x 106 N. For safety, the cable must support twice that load.

(a) Find what cross-sectional area should the cable have if it's to be made of steel?

m2

(b) Determine by how much will a 9.0 meter length of this cable stretch when subject to the 1.4 x 106 Newton load?
